India’s Chief of Naval Staff calls on Foreign Minister

Thursday, February 26th, 2009

Chairman of the Chiefs of Staff Committee and Chief of Naval Staff of India Admiral Sureesh Mehta, has paid a courtesy call on the Minister of Foreign Affairs Dr. Ahmed Shaheed. The meeting was held today at the Ministry of Foreign Affairs.

Minister Dr. Shaheed and Admiral Sureesh Mehta discussed issues of mutual interest, and exchanged views on ways to enhance the existing close friendly bilateral ties between the two countries.

The call was also attended by the Minister of State for Foreign Affairs Ahmed Naseem, Indian High Commissioner to the Maldives, A.K. Pandey and some senior officials from the Indian Navy.
